13:13You were saying before that Wyndon's a very technical circuit.
13:18What do you mean by technical circuit?
13:19Well, it's one of those circuits that has got so many different corners on it
13:22and you've got to apply yourself very differently to most of them.
13:25But it's very hard to get such a clean lap around here
13:29because you're working so very, very hard all the time.
13:32It's just one of those places we call technical
13:35because it is very hard to get a fast lap around.

21:54Probably the most important safety aspect of any V8 supercar
21:59would have to be the roll cage.
22:01It has a dual purpose.
22:02Firstly, for stiffness of the chassis.
22:04And secondly, but more importantly,
22:07for the safety of the driver in case of an accident.
22:10Safety and comfort is paramount in any race car.
22:14That's why the seat's so important.
22:16Because if you're not comfortable,
22:17you sure as hell haven't got your mind on the job.
22:21Another life-saving device aboard a V8 supercar
22:24is this onboard fire system,
22:26which can be activated externally by a marshal
22:29or from the cockpit by a driver.
22:31On our Shell Helix Falcons, we choose to run a window net,
22:35which in case of a heavy impact,
22:37the driver stays within the compartment.
22:40These are just a few of the safety features on a V8 supercar.
